Sdílet prostřednictvím


Trustee Konstruktory

Definice

Inicializuje novou instanci Trustee třídy.

Přetížení

Trustee()

Inicializuje novou instanci Trustee třídy bez nastavení některé z jejích vlastností pro čtení a zápis.

Trustee(String)

Inicializuje novou instanci třídy typu Unknown, nastaví Name vlastnost na zadanou hodnotu a na SystemNamenull.Trustee

Trustee(String, String)

Inicializuje novou instanci Trustee třídy typu Unknown, nastaví Name vlastnosti a SystemName na zadané hodnoty.

Trustee(String, String, TrusteeType)

Inicializuje novou instanci Trustee třídy zadaného typu a nastaví Name vlastnosti a SystemName na zadané hodnoty.

Trustee()

Inicializuje novou instanci Trustee třídy bez nastavení některé z jejích vlastností pro čtení a zápis.

public:
 Trustee();
public Trustee ();
Public Sub New ()

Poznámky

Před použitím Trustee instance k Name nastavení oprávnění je nutné zadat hodnotu vlastnosti. Volitelně můžete vlastnost nastavit SystemName tak, aby identifikovala název systému, ve kterém je účet správce vyhledán, a přeložila identifikátor zabezpečení názvu. Pokud nezadáte hodnotu pro SystemName, místní počítač vyhledá název účtu.

Platí pro

Trustee(String)

Inicializuje novou instanci třídy typu Unknown, nastaví Name vlastnost na zadanou hodnotu a na SystemNamenull.Trustee

public:
 Trustee(System::String ^ name);
public Trustee (string name);
new System.Messaging.Trustee : string -> System.Messaging.Trustee
Public Sub New (name As String)

Parametry

name
String

Hodnota, která se má přiřadit vlastnosti Name .

Výjimky

Parametr name je null.

Poznámky

Toto přetížení použijte k nastavení účtu správce a určení, že se k vyhledání účtu použije místní počítač. Vlastnost TrusteeType je nastavena na Unknown, ale tuto hodnotu můžete upravit před použitím této instance Trustee k nastavení oprávnění.

Viz také

Platí pro

Trustee(String, String)

Inicializuje novou instanci Trustee třídy typu Unknown, nastaví Name vlastnosti a SystemName na zadané hodnoty.

public:
 Trustee(System::String ^ name, System::String ^ systemName);
public Trustee (string name, string systemName);
new System.Messaging.Trustee : string * string -> System.Messaging.Trustee
Public Sub New (name As String, systemName As String)

Parametry

name
String

Hodnota, která se má přiřadit vlastnosti Name .

systemName
String

Hodnota, která se má přiřadit vlastnosti SystemName .

Výjimky

Parametr name je null.

Poznámky

Toto přetížení použijte k nastavení účtu správce a určení, že se k vyhledání účtu použije síťový počítač. Vlastnost TrusteeType je nastavena na Unknown, ale tuto hodnotu můžete upravit před použitím této instance Trustee k nastavení oprávnění.

Viz také

Platí pro

Trustee(String, String, TrusteeType)

Inicializuje novou instanci Trustee třídy zadaného typu a nastaví Name vlastnosti a SystemName na zadané hodnoty.

public:
 Trustee(System::String ^ name, System::String ^ systemName, System::Messaging::TrusteeType trusteeType);
public Trustee (string name, string systemName, System.Messaging.TrusteeType trusteeType);
new System.Messaging.Trustee : string * string * System.Messaging.TrusteeType -> System.Messaging.Trustee
Public Sub New (name As String, systemName As String, trusteeType As TrusteeType)

Parametry

name
String

Hodnota, která se má přiřadit vlastnosti Name .

systemName
String

Hodnota, která se má přiřadit vlastnosti SystemName .

trusteeType
TrusteeType

A TrusteeType , který označuje typ účtu správce.

Výjimky

Parametr name je null.

Poznámky

Toto přetížení použijte, pokud je známo, že typ správce nastaví účet správce a určí síťový počítač, který se má použít k vyhledání účtu.

Toto přetížení nastaví TrusteeType vlastnost při konstrukci, ale tuto hodnotu můžete upravit před použitím této instance Trustee k nastavení oprávnění. Typ Unknown správce (který ostatní přetížení konstruktoru nastavený ve výchozím nastavení) by měl být použit pouze v případě, že neznáte druh vztahu důvěryhodnosti, který se používá, ale víte, že je platný.

Viz také

Platí pro